Edward Norton settles controversy over "The Avengers"

The actor Edward Norton has decided to make a statement on its Facebook page to settle the controversy of his exclusion from the film «The Avengers ", where he should have played" The Hulk "again:

“As most of you know, I don't like to talk a lot about the business of making films because it is paramount for me to protect the audience so that they fully enjoy all the magic that a film has. But I am so grateful for the support received from fans of 'Hulk' and 'The Avengers' that I feel it would be impolite not to respond. So here it goes:
Looks like I won't be playing Buce Banner for Marvel in 'The Avengers' again. I sincerely hoped it would happen and that it would be great for everyone, but it didn't turn out the way we all expected. I know this is disappointing for a lot of people and this saddens me. But I am sincerely very grateful to Marvel for giving me the opportunity to be a part of the great and long history of the Hulk. And I can't thank the fans enough for all the enthusiasm they have sent me about what Louis and I are trying to do with the legend on our turn. It means a lot to me. I grew up with Banner and the Hulk and have been a fan of every performance. I am truly proud and blessed to have been one of them and will be delighted to see it live through other actors. The Hulk is bigger than all of us, that's why we love him, right? »
